Employment Process
Hiring Procedure – Applicants must possess the minimum qualifications by the final filing date.
All qualified applicants may participate in the selection process. Employment
lists are established upon successful completion of the selection process. The
candidates must be successful in each part of the examination. To fill each
vacancy the hiring department will request names to be certified from the
eligible list and will make a selection from this certification list.

AMERICANS
WITH DISABILITIES ACT – The City of Lodi provides reasonable accommodation for
qualified individuals with disabilities. Individuals with disabilities
requiring any accommodation in order to participate in the selection process,
must submit a written request for reasonable accommodation to the Human
Resources Department no later than the final filing date as stated on the job
announcement.
MEDICAL
EXAMINATION – Applicants should not quit or give notice to their current
employers until an offer of employment has been made and they have been notified
of the successful completion of the appropriate medical examination.
DRUG
SCREENING – Under the requirements of the Drug Free Workplace Act of 1988, the
City of Lodi has been designated as a drug-free workplace. All offers of
employment will be contingent upon successful completion of a drug and alcohol
screening.
FINGERPRINTING – All
applicants prior to employment must be fingerprinted and cleared through the
California Department of Justice in accordance with the City of Lodi resolution
2001-201.
